Why do we forecast solar and wind data in optimisation problems ?
What is its necessity ?

Respuestas (1)

Walter Roberson
Walter Roberson el 13 de Sept. de 2020
Why not? Solar wind is important, and there is a lot of a available data for it.
Or if you were talking about solar data independently of wind data, then solar data is important for forecasting the potential energy production of solar cells, and wind data is important for forecasting the potential energy production of wind turbines.
